#16
Ask to Pombas as He wanted Original Bios Decrypted and I got from Original
Bios File not from You Wink just to say that this is not our big problem !!!
I know that We cannot modify any sign into Bios as It is Signed !
Using Falseclock Method, We can modify the VarStore Variables like VT or Others,
but cannot show Avanced and Power and not modify code to remove Whitelist . . .
I can remove the Sinature Check, but can rewrite Bios Mod Back only using an
HW SPI Programmer ! (Donovan6k has found a way and He is Simply The Best !!!)
So if anyone has more news He is welcome Wink !!!

#19
Found old version of bios for this notebook. Ver: F.02. Can you guys watch this for unlock? I have spi.


Besides, in that version of bios working EFI Shell and you can change some options without brick. 


1. Write bios rom F.02 with SPI programmer to notebook.
2. Download EFI Shell and put it on empty usb flash.
3. Boot from usb flash and enter efi shell
4. Type "setup_var variable value" . For example: setup_var 0x183 0x40

Variables and value you can take from ifr.txt in archive. 

Options that i have tested:
1.Primary video adapter - brick.
2. UMA Buffer size - not brick. Set internal video memory to 60mb:  setup_var 0x183 0x40
You can experiment with other options
